Locating The Bluetooth Button On Your Dell Keyboard
Locating the Bluetooth button on your Dell keyboard is essential for connecting to other devices wirelessly. In most Dell keyboards, the Bluetooth button is located near the top right corner, often next to the power button. It’s typically small and labeled with the Bluetooth symbol, making it easily recognizable.
If you can’t find the physical button, check the function keys at the top of the keyboard. Look for a key with a Bluetooth symbol or a label that indicates Bluetooth functionality. Sometimes, pressing and holding the Fn key while pressing the corresponding function key with the Bluetooth symbol can activate Bluetooth on your Dell keyboard.
If you are still unable to locate the Bluetooth button or key, refer to the user manual that came with your Dell keyboard. The manual will provide specific instructions and a detailed illustration of where to find the Bluetooth button. Additionally, you can visit Dell’s official website and search for the keyboard model to access online guides and resources for finding the Bluetooth button.
Activating Bluetooth Mode
To activate Bluetooth mode on your Dell keyboard, start by locating the Bluetooth button. Usually, this button is found on the top right or left corner of the keyboard, marked with the recognizable Bluetooth symbol. Once located, press and hold the Bluetooth button for a few seconds until the Bluetooth indicator light starts flashing. This indicates that the keyboard is now in pairing mode and ready to connect to other devices.
Next, navigate to the settings on the device you want to pair with the keyboard and turn on its Bluetooth function. Search for available Bluetooth devices and select the Dell keyboard from the list of available devices. Follow the prompts to complete the pairing process, and once successfully paired, the Bluetooth indicator light on the keyboard will stop flashing and remain solid, indicating a successful connection. Now you can enjoy the convenience of using your Dell keyboard wirelessly with your paired device.
It’s important to note that different models of Dell keyboards may have slightly different methods for activating Bluetooth mode, so always refer to the user manual for specific instructions tailored to your keyboard model.
Pairing Your Dell Keyboard With A Device
To pair your Dell keyboard with a device, start by ensuring that your device’s Bluetooth is turned on. Locate the Bluetooth button on your Dell keyboard, typically located on the right side, near the top edge. Press and hold the Bluetooth button for a few seconds until the LED indicator starts flashing, indicating that the keyboard is in pairing mode.
Next, on your device, navigate to the Bluetooth settings and search for available devices. Look for the Dell keyboard in the list of available devices and select it to initiate the pairing process. You may be prompted to enter a pairing code, which can typically be found in the keyboard’s user manual or will be displayed on your device’s screen. Once the pairing code is entered, the device and keyboard should connect, and the LED indicator on the keyboard will stop flashing, indicating a successful pairing.
After successful pairing, you can start using your Dell keyboard with the paired device. Remember, the specific steps may vary slightly depending on the model of your Dell keyboard and the device you are pairing it with, so always refer to the user manual for detailed instructions.
Troubleshooting Bluetooth Connection Issues
In case you encounter Bluetooth connection issues with your Dell keyboard, there are several troubleshooting steps to help resolve the issue. Start by ensuring that the keyboard’s Bluetooth is turned on. This can usually be done by pressing the Bluetooth button and holding it for a few seconds until the indicator light starts blinking. Once the keyboard is in pairing mode, try reconnecting it to your device.
If you continue to experience connection problems, you can attempt resetting the Bluetooth connection by removing the keyboard from the list of paired devices on your computer or mobile device and then re-pairing it. Additionally, make sure that the keyboard is within the recommended range for Bluetooth connectivity and that there are no physical obstructions or interference from other electronic devices.
If these steps do not resolve the issue, consider updating the keyboard’s firmware or drivers. You can do this by visiting Dell’s official support website and downloading the latest available updates for your specific keyboard model. Lastly, if the problem persists, reaching out to Dell’s customer support for further assistance may be necessary.

Extending Battery Life And Managing Bluetooth Connectivity
To extend the battery life of your Dell keyboard and effectively manage Bluetooth connectivity, consider a few easy-to-implement strategies. First, disabling Bluetooth when not in use can significantly prolong battery life. By turning off Bluetooth when it’s not needed, you can conserve battery power and maximize the overall lifespan of your keyboard. Additionally, consider adjusting the sleep mode settings for your keyboard to automatically disconnect from Bluetooth when inactive for a predetermined period, further prolonging battery life.
In terms of managing Bluetooth connectivity, keeping your keyboard and the connected device within the recommended Bluetooth range can help maintain a stable connection while minimizing power consumption. Furthermore, regularly checking for and installing any available firmware or driver updates for your Dell keyboard can help ensure optimized Bluetooth performance and enhanced battery efficiency.
